WHO IS IT? Gilbert Neal. WHAT IS THIS? Gilbert Neal’s new 2013 CD, “Dirty Red Pagan”. A CD funded in part by a successful Kickstarter campaign. WHAT’S THE MUSIC LIKE? It’s pop/soul. Fast numbers, slow ones, ballads, humor and true life stories. Sounds like Stevie Wonder and Steely Dan had a baby and made it listen to David Bowie and the Swingle Singers all its wretched but funky life. WHO’S PLAYING? Gilbert Neal on vocals, piano, guitar and bass. Steve Camilleri on drums, Darrelll Nutt on percussion, Marko Marisic on good guitar parts, and Pamela Henderson on backing vocals. WHAT’S A “DIRTY RED PAGAN”? An anagram of “Andy Partridge”. The great XTC front-man gave his enthusiastic blessing to use that as the CD’s title. It’s an apt one considering the somewhat socialist, somewhat sexual, and somewhat godless messages in the lyrics. WHO IS GILBERT NEAL? A multi-instrumentalist and songwriter. He was born in Buffalo, NY and now lives in Hillsborough, NC. He has performed in many kinds of ensembles through the years. Jazz, theater, funk, 50’s, soul, prog, etc. This is his 4th complete solo work, the previous three being Drink The Beast With Me (2006), “Our Deepest Apathy” (2008) and Vultures and Diamonds (2010).
